Macondo partners parry payment claims from BP for oil spill

11/22/2010
Eric WatkinsOil Diplomacy EditorAnadarko Petroleum Corp. and Mitsui Oil Exploration (Moeco), co-owners with BP PLC in the Macondo oil well, have not changed their views on payment of costs for the Deepwater Horizon oil spill that occurred in the Gulf of Mexico earlier this year.So far, BP has paid all the expenses from the spill, but is seeking payment from all companies involved in the joint venture.
